1. Explore Southeast Asia for Unbeatable Prices

Southeast Asia is a haven for travelers looking for affordable getaways. Countries like Thailand, Vietnam, and Cambodia offer beautiful landscapes, rich culture, and budget-friendly accommodations. You can find charming hostels, guesthouses, and affordable hotels, along with cheap and delicious street food. The cost of activities, such as guided tours, temple visits, and local excursions, is also very low compared to other parts of the world, making it an ideal destination for traveling on a budget.

2. Eastern Europe: Affordable and Rich in History

Eastern Europe is often overlooked by travelers, but it’s a treasure trove of history, culture, and affordable travel experiences. Cities like Budapest, Prague, and Bucharest offer a perfect blend of rich history, stunning architecture, and incredibly low costs. Accommodation and food are generally much cheaper here compared to Western Europe, so you can stretch your travel budget much further. Whether you’re interested in sightseeing, exploring old castles, or enjoying local cuisine, Eastern Europe provides plenty of cheap getaways that won’t break the bank.

3. South America: Affordable Adventure Awaits

South America offers a wide range of destinations for travelers looking to experience vibrant cultures, breathtaking landscapes, and budget-friendly activities. Cities like Lima, Peru, and Medellín, Colombia, are both affordable and packed with things to do. From hiking the Inca Trail to exploring the Amazon rainforest or relaxing on beautiful beaches, South America is a perfect option for affordable travel. Additionally, public transportation is cheap, and you can easily find budget accommodations, making it an ideal choice for those seeking travel on a budget.

4. Mexico: A Close and Affordable Getaway

For travelers in North America, Mexico is one of the most affordable getaways. Whether you’re relaxing on the beaches of Tulum, exploring ancient Mayan ruins in Mérida, or wandering the vibrant streets of Mexico City, Mexico offers a rich cultural experience at a fraction of the price of other destinations. Public transportation, food, and activities are all reasonably priced, making it a great choice for budget travel.

How to Save on Flights for Cheap Getaways

5. Be Flexible with Your Travel Dates

One of the best ways to save money on flights is by being flexible with your travel dates. Airfare prices can vary significantly depending on the time of year, day of the week, and even the time of day. By adjusting your travel schedule to avoid peak seasons or booking flights during sales, you can find incredible deals on affordable travel. Use fare comparison websites like Google Flights, Skyscanner, and Momondo to monitor prices and get alerts when they drop.

6. Use Budget Airlines for Affordable Travel

Budget airlines are a game-changer when it comes to travel on a budget. Airlines like Ryanair, EasyJet, and Southwest offer low-cost flights to major cities, often for a fraction of the price of traditional carriers. While these flights may not include luxury amenities, they provide a fast and cheap way to get to your destination. By packing light and avoiding extra fees for checked luggage, you can keep your travel costs even lower.

Affordable Accommodations for Every Wallet

7. Stay in Hostels and Guesthouses

When it comes to budget travel, hostels and guesthouses are excellent alternatives to expensive hotels. Hostels are not just for backpackers—they often offer private rooms at a fraction of the cost of traditional hotels, along with shared dormitories for even cheaper rates. Many hostels also provide free amenities like Wi-Fi, breakfast, and city tours, adding more value to your stay. Guesthouses are another affordable option that provides a more intimate experience and a taste of local culture.

8. Consider Vacation Rentals and Homestays

Vacation rentals and homestays are another great option for affordable getaways. Websites like Airbnb and Vrbo offer entire apartments, rooms, or homes that can often be cheaper than booking a hotel. Staying with a local host can also provide you with insider knowledge about the best attractions, restaurants, and activities in the area, helping you save even more money while experiencing authentic local life.

How to Save on Food and Activities While Traveling on a Budget

9. Eat Like a Local

One of the best ways to save money while traveling is by eating like a local. Street food is not only cheap but also delicious and authentic. In many countries, street vendors offer fresh and tasty meals at prices far below what you’d pay in a touristy restaurant. Local markets are also a great place to pick up fresh produce and snacks on the go. By avoiding high-end restaurants and eating where the locals do, you can enjoy amazing food without draining your travel on a budget fund.

10. Find Free or Cheap Things to Do

Many destinations offer free or low-cost activities that allow you to explore the local culture without spending much. Free walking tours, hiking trails, city parks, and cultural festivals can all be enjoyed at little to no cost. Research free activities in your destination before your trip, and make sure to take advantage of any discounts or free entry days at museums, galleries, and historical sites. This way, you can enjoy your vacation without worrying about high activity costs.
